WHAT THIS ROLE WILL DO
Live Nation is seeking a Backstage Experience  Coordinator  for  Red Hat Amphitheater . The position will directly report to the venue General Manger. The Backstage Experience  Coordinator  (BE C ) will  be responsible for  administering various  Live Nation  and venue designed programs to support local production & touring personnel.  The Backstage Experience  Coordinator  will  maintain   back of house  expectations & backstage division-wide goals while ensuring that our Artist Commitment is met or exceeded.  This role will act as a hospitality focused position ensuring a phenomenal experience for touring personnel backstage.  This is a seasonal, hourly position. Scheduled hours will vary depending on business needs and may be scheduled up to  40 hours  per week or more during peak season.
Job Functions:
• In partnership with the venue General Manager  and Production Manager , the B ackstage Experience C oordinator   is resp onsible for  administering various Live Nation and venue designed programs to support local production & touring personnel.
• The Backstage Experience  Coordinator  will  maintain   back-of-house  hospitality expectations & backstage division-wide goals.
• The Backstage Experience  Coordinator  will meet & greet the tours upon arrival  at  the venue and be available to assign dressing rooms   and  is  the point of contact for all hospitality needs.
• Where possible- wash, dry and fold all  tour  laundry as well as hand and bath towels. The Backstage Experience  Coordinator  will check dressing rooms periodically through the day to tidy up and collect any towels to be washed .
• Partner with local backstage catering to ensure the Artists rider requirements are met and the culinary experience exceeds the artist's and touring personnel's expectations.
• Show CARE by  participating  in the venue's sustainability program which could include implementing programs that conserve resources/prevent waste such as  sorting waste and collecting recycling  and educating the bands about our efforts.
• Will be the backstage brand ambassador and the face of the service culture program.
• Responsible for completing the Post Event Service Recap and  analyze  other venue service reports to create action plans for service improvements in partnership with the Artist Services team & Venue GM.
• Research best practices and collaborate with the Artist Services team & Venue GM
to develop venue opportunities to increase engagement, increase Artist/Crew satisfaction.
• Work with Production Managers & Catering Teams to help  facilitate  advances.
• Pre  and  post-show  walk through with checklist to make ready all backstage Artist & Touring crew areas and notate any damage to be repairs.
• Oversee  all dressing room and bus stock, including after-show meal coordination.
• In coordination with the General and Production Managers, co-manage any applicable backstage program budget and process vendor invoices.
• Will act as the lead in  maintaining  metrics and sharing information with the Artist Services Team, tracking historic   data on Tours & details  regarding  Artist choices/favorites and manage the backstage tour personnel survey and competition rate for your venue.
• Partner with the venue's Production Manager, Artist Services team and LN Tour rep to create memorable, hospitality-minded moments at every show, including but not limited to birthdays and special celebrations.
